| Father, son face drug, weapon charges |
|
RAMAPO – A father and son are facing drug and weapon possession charges after a traffic stop by State Troopers assigned to Tarrytown barracks. Officers stopped a northbound vehicle on the Thruway in the Town of Ramapo and found 100 glassine envelopes of heroin with a street value of $2,500 on Angel DeAngelo, Sr., 35, of Amsterdam, NY. A search of the vehicle revealed a loaded sawed-off 12 gauge Ithaca model shotgun with a pistol grip, located in the trunk. Angel DeAngelo, Jr. 18, of Amsterdam, NY, was charged with criminal possession of a weapon in the second degree. The elder DeAngelo was charged with criminal possession controlled substance in the third and seventh degrees. Both defendants were arraigned and remanded to the Rockland County Jail in lieu of $50,000 bail for DeAngelo, Sr and $25,000 bail for DeAngelo, Jr. |
